Why do people get charges like this from Guilford College?
- Tuition Payments: Students might see charges related to their tuition fees for enrolled courses.
- Housing Fees: Charges can be incurred from on-campus housing or dormitory fees.
- Meal Plans: Students often choose meal plans which can result in recurring charges.
- Library Fees: Late fees or charges for lost or unreturned library materials can appear on student accounts.
- Parking Permits: Fees for parking passes or citations for parking violations on campus.
- Activity Fees: Some students are charged fees related to student organizations or campus activities.
- Health Services: Charges from using health services provided by the college, including counseling or medical visits.
- Course Materials: Purchase of textbooks or other materials through the college bookstore can result in charges.
- Technology Fees: Costs associated with the use of campus technology resources, such as computer labs.
- Equipment Rentals: Charges from renting equipment for classes, such as sports gear or lab tools.
